Output 6576078d1d4397bb88531e84075bbfbcee484dfce317bce37a439de8b944b5c0:0

value
801936
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12b8fb95e2d1918caa04ce0009056e53d3686c3f OP_EQUALVERIFY OP_CHECKSIG
address
12hzmHFRBtq4SDraCHaqXUaCADph7yhPxx
transaction
6576078d1d4397bb88531e84075bbfbcee484dfce317bce37a439de8b944b5c0
spent
true